Seiko Prospex 1986 Diver's 35th Anniversary Bilingual JDM Limited Edition SBBN051

Seiko Prospex 1986 Diver's 35th Anniversary Bilingual JDM Limited Edition SBBN051

A fitting tribute to the legendary Seiko "Tuna"

In 1986, Seiko launched a diver's watch that set a new standard. It combined Seiko's legendary 1975 design with a 1,000 meter water resistance for saturation diving with a quartz movement that delivered an accuracy that no mechanical diver's watch could match. At the time, and still today, it was recognized as one of Seiko's most important diver's watches. Today, 35 years later, this classic Seiko Diver's watch is re-born as reference S23635 with new design features and upgraded professional diver's watch specifications.

This new referenceĀ is purpose-built to live up toĀ the promise of the Prospex name. The dial color has a gradation from blue to black to dramatize the way that light gradually fades as one dives deeper into the dark, mysterious world of the ocean. It incorporates the unique one-piece titanium case with its outer protector structure that makes its shock resistance so exceptional. The crown is marked with a vivid yellow 'Lock' sign and an arrow to indicate the rotating direction. The winding stem is also in yellow so that the wearer can immediately notice if the crown is unlocked. Following ISO standards for saturation diving at depths of up to 1,000 meters, this high-intensity watch is powered by a quartz caliber 7C46 movement, engineered specifically for diver's watches with increased torque to move the heavy hands, as well as enhanced battery life. Including a day/date window, LumiBrite hands and markers, sapphire crystal and a stainless steel bezel with super-hard coating, this landmark timepiece comes packaged in a special collectors' box.
